Calculus textbooks like to give you totally funky, disjointed graphs, and ask you to find the limit at various points along the graph.
The purpose of this is to make sure you understand the concept of oneside limits (left and righthand limits), and the difference between onesided limits and general limits. Questions like this also make you show that you know the difference between the value of the function at a particular point and its limit at the same point.
In this video we'll do a limit problem with a crazy graph and examine several points where the function is discontinuous, to find the value of the left and righthand limits, the general limit, and the value of the function itself.
